#17da95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17da95 is composed of 9% red, 85.5%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 47.3%. #17da95 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00b52b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#17da95 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#17da95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17da95 has RGB values of R:23, G:218,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1563285.

Shades and Tints of #17da95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f2f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#17da95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747d7a is the less saturated color, while #04ed9a is the most saturated one.
